Why find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ains needs a policy

This tool queries Active Directory to discover domains with non-expiring smartcard configurations—a reconnaissance operation with no side effects. It retrieves data for security analysis purposes.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ains' indicates a query operation that retrieves information about domains with smartcard certificates that don't expire. The tool is part of BloodHound's attack path analysis suite which queries Active Directory data.

How to control find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ains

PolicyLayer is an MCP gateway — it sits between your AI agents and BloodHound MCP, and nothing reaches the server without passing your rules. This is the rule we recommend for find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ains:

policy.json
{
  "version": "1",
  "default": "deny",
  "tools": {
    "find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ains": {}
  }
}

find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ains is read-only, so it stays allowed — but everything else on the server is denied unless you say otherwise.

Can I rate-limit find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for find_smartcard_dont_expire_domains.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
